Smooth feedback, global stabilization, and disturbance attenuation of nonlinear systems with uncontrollable linearization (English)
0 references
The authors consider a class of highly nonlinear systems that are comprised of a lower dimensional zero-dynamics subsystem and a chain of power integrators perturbed by a nontriangular vector field. They develop a systematic design procedure for the explicit construction of smooth feedback controllers which globally stabilize the system in the absence of additive disturbances and attenuate the effect of the disturbance of the output.
